Most car problems don’t arrive suddenly. They build up slowly over months of small things being ignored. Regular servicing is what catches those small things before they become expensive ones.
What Regular Servicing Actually Does for a Car
Oil breaks down over time. Filters get clogged. Brake pads wear thin. Belts stretch and crack. None of this is visible from the driver’s seat — but all of it affects how the car performs and how long it lasts.
A proper service goes through each of these systematically. Fresh oil means the engine runs cooler and cleaner. A new air filter means the engine breathes properly and burns fuel more efficiently. Brake inspections catch wear before it reaches the point where stopping distance is actually affected.
For luxury and performance cars, this matters even more. A Maserati isn’t engineered to run on degraded oil or worn components. The tolerances are tighter, the parts are more precise, and the consequences of neglect show up faster and cost more to fix. The Equipment Gap Between Good Workshops and Average Ones
Here’s something most car owners don’t think about until they’re already in trouble. Not every workshop has the tools to properly service every car. This isn’t about skill alone — it’s about equipment.

BMW has its own diagnostic system — ISTA — that gives detailed fault trees, live data readings, and guided repair procedures. A BMW service center Dubai without access to this system is essentially reading partial information about what’s wrong with the car. That leads to parts being replaced unnecessarily, or actual faults being missed entirely.
The lift equipment matters too. Certain undercarriage work on low-slung performance cars requires specific lift points and adapters. Using the wrong setup risks damaging components that sit very close to the chassis on these vehicles.
Wheel alignment on luxury vehicles needs laser alignment systems calibrated to manufacturer specifications — not a general-purpose machine set to generic tolerances. Tyre pressure monitoring systems, battery registration after replacement, adaptive headlight calibration — all of these require specific tools that a properly equipped specialist workshop will have as standard.
